Cost of Living in Lecheria - Updated Prices & Insights

Monthly Cost of Living

Living costs for one person come to about $892 monthly including rent, or $580 excluding housing.

Estimated monthly costs for a couple: $1,485 with rent, or $1,123 without housing.

Monthly costs for a family of three come to about $2,079 including rent, or $1,666 for daily expenses alone.

Is the cost of living in Lecheria reasonable?
At around $892 monthly all-in, Lecheria offers decent value. It's not the cheapest and not the priciest – a good fit for people who want city convenience without capital-level costs.
What are the monthly living expenses in Lecheria as of 2026?
As of 2026, monthly living costs in Lecheria come to around $892 including rent, or roughly $580 excluding it. Numbers shift a bit by season and neighborhood, but this range works well as a planning baseline.
What income level supports a comfortable lifestyle in Lecheria?
Earning $1,338 monthly in Lecheria means you're living well – a one-bedroom, regular groceries, transport, and some entertainment without stress. That's the threshold where most residents feel genuinely comfortable rather than just getting by.
What does a one-bedroom apartment cost in Lecheria per month?
Where you live in Lecheria makes all the difference. Central one-bedrooms cost about $429; commute-friendly outer districts come in around $194. Overall, the market runs from $194 to $429 depending on size, location, and apartment condition.
Is food shopping expensive in Lecheria?
Expect to spend around $284 per month on groceries in Lecheria. Neither cheap nor expensive by global standards – everyday items are fairly priced, though imported or specialty products cost more.
How much is a monthly gym pass in Lecheria?
A regular gym membership in Lecheria costs around $60.5 monthly. It's a reasonable expense that fits into most budgets, and you generally get decent facilities for the price.
